Understanding Ferret Odor
Ferrets are playful, energetic pets, but they can sometimes come with a distinct odor. This smell largely stems from their natural musk, which is a characteristic of their species. While ferrets are generally clean animals, their scent can be intensified by factors such as diet, age, and overall health. Understanding the source of this odor is crucial for ferret owners who wish to maintain a fresh-smelling environment.
To combat the natural odor of ferrets, it’s essential to maintain their living space with regular cleaning. Removing soiled bedding, changing litter frequently, and washing their toys can significantly reduce unpleasant smells. Additionally, monitoring their diet can also help; a healthier, balanced diet can lead to less odor production. While air fresheners can help mask these odors, addressing their source is equally important for long-term scent management.

Natural Alternatives to Chemical Air Fresheners
For pet owners concerned about the potential effects of synthetic fragrances on their ferrets, considering natural alternatives is a wise choice. Many air fresheners on the market contain chemicals that can be harmful to pets. Natural options, such as essential oil diffusers with ferret-safe oils, can offer a fresher aroma without the risks associated with synthetic fragrances.
Additionally, simple solutions like baking soda can be used to neutralize odors effectively. Placing an open box of baking soda in your ferret’s area can absorb unwanted smells without adding any harsh chemicals to their environment. Another option is to use white vinegar, which can be diluted in water and used as a natural spray to help with odor control. This versatile solution is not only budget-friendly but also safe for your pets.
Incorporating houseplants that are safe for ferrets can also enhance your living space. Some plants, such as spider plants or Boston ferns, not only improve air quality but can also produce a subtle natural fragrance. Thus, combining multiple natural odor-fighting strategies can create a more pleasant environment for your ferrets and their owners.
Tips for Maintaining a Fresh Ferret Environment
Maintaining a fresh living area for ferrets goes beyond the occasional spritz of air freshener. Developing a cleaning routine is imperative in minimizing odors. Regularly washing bedding, cleaning cages, and washing food and water dishes can significantly contribute to a healthier environment. Using pet-safe cleaning products also ensures that you’re not introducing harmful substances that could affect your ferret’s health.
Limit the accumulation of dirt and hair by creating a designated play area. This can help contain messes and reduce overall cleaning time. If your ferret enjoys exploring outside of their cage, consider creating a safe, easy-to-clean space for them to play. Using washable blankets can also aid in maintaining cleanliness and comfort, as they can be easily replaced and cleaned.
Implementing proper ventilation in your home can also play a crucial role in reducing odors. Open windows when possible to promote fresh air circulation, and consider using exhaust fans if your ferret’s area is enclosed. By combining regular maintenance with effective air freshening methods, you will create a more enjoyable environment for both you and your beloved ferrets.

3. Type of Air Freshener
There are several types of air fresheners available, each with its benefits and downsides. Popular options include sprays, plug-ins, gels, and natural alternatives like baking soda. Sprays can provide immediate relief but may require frequent reapplication. Plug-ins tend to offer a more consistent level of fragrance but must be properly monitored to ensure they remain safe around your ferret.
Gels can be an excellent option as they often rely on non-toxic ingredients and can last longer than sprays. Natural alternatives, such as baking soda or activated charcoal, can absorb odors effectively without introducing any synthetic fragrances. Consider your lifestyle and how much effort you’re willing to invest in maintaining a fresh environment to determine which type of air freshener is most suitable for your needs.

2. How can I control odors from my ferret’s litter box?
To effectively manage odors from a ferret’s litter box, it is best to establish a regular cleaning routine. Removing waste daily and replacing litter as needed will help prevent odors from building up. Using a litter specifically designed for small animals can also absorb odors better than regular cat litter.
In addition to regular cleaning, consider using baking soda to neutralize odors before adding fresh litter. Some ferret owners find that placing an air freshener in the vicinity of the litter box can also help, but it is essential to choose a safe product. Alternatively, look for odor-absorbing natural products such as activated charcoal or zeolite.

7. What are the best practices for keeping my ferret’s space odor-free?
To maintain an odor-free environment for your ferret, start with a consistent cleaning regimen that includes daily spot cleaning of the litter box and weekly full cleanings of the entire habitat. Remove old bedding and replace it with fresh material to keep your ferret’s space clean and inviting. Regularly washing toys and accessories can also help eliminate odors.
Additionally, consider adding a few natural odor absorbers, like baking soda or activated charcoal, to the enclosure. Always ensure proper ventilation in the area where your ferrets live, as fresh air circulation will help reduce stagnant smells. Positioning an appropriate air freshener, while ensuring it’s safe for pets, can also help keep the environment pleasant without compromising your ferret’s health.
